Doornogue is a detached cottage situated at the end of the Hook Peninsula, two miles from the village of Fethard-on-Sea in County Wexford. This cottage has five bedrooms, consisting of two double bedrooms, one of which is on the ground floor, two twin bedrooms, one on the ground floor and one family room with two double beds with ensuite bathroom, meaning the cottage sleeps twelve people. There are also two shower rooms, one on the ground floor. The cottage has an open plan living area with fitted kitchen, dining area and sitting area with open fire and patio doors. There is also a first floor sitting room with open fire and sea views. Outside, this cottage has off road parking for two cars, with additional roadside parking and a rear lawned garden with decking, furniture and BBQ. The Old School House is a brick built, detached dormer bungalow in an elevated position overlooking the Irish Sea just three miles from the town of Gorey in County Wexford. Comprising three bedrooms (one twin, one with adult bunks and one double with an ensuite) as well as a sofa bed and a family bathroom, this cottage can sleep eight people. Also in the cottage is a fitted kitchen with a dining table, a sitting room with a woodburning stove and a first floor sitting room with the sofa bed. Outside the cottage is a lawned garden with furniture and off road parking for four cars.
